  • Unprecedented Tiger Deaths in Madhya Pradesh: 54 Fatalities in 2025 Raise Serious Conservation Concerns

    Unprecedented Tiger Deaths in Madhya Pradesh: 54 Fatalities in 2025 Raise Serious Conservation Concerns

    Dec 16, 2025 08:31 pm CST

    Madhya Pradesh's status as India's "Tiger State" is under threat with an unprecedented 54 tiger deaths recorded in 2025, the highest annual mortality rate since Project Tiger began in 1973. With 57% of deaths classified as "unnatural" due to poaching, electrocution, or unexplained circumstances, conservation experts are questioning the effectiveness of current protection measures and calling for urgent action to address this growing crisis.

  • Cook and Staff Suspended After Worms Found in Karnataka School Mid-Day Meals: Officials Take Swift Action

    Cook and Staff Suspended After Worms Found in Karnataka School Mid-Day Meals: Officials Take Swift Action

    Dec 16, 2025 08:31 pm CST

    Karnataka's Koppal district administration suspended a cook and two staff members after discovering worms in school mid-day meals. Deputy Commissioner Suresh B Itnal personally inspected food storage facilities, implemented stricter quality controls, and ordered district-wide school inspections to prevent future incidents. The contamination, traced to infected dal that should have been discarded, has raised significant concerns among parents about food safety in the school meal program.

    Rahul Gandhi Slams Modi Government's G RAM G Bill as Direct Attack on Mahatma Gandhi's Legacy and Rural Poor

    Dec 16, 2025 07:41 pm CST

    Congress leader Rahul Gandhi has strongly criticized the BJP government's new G RAM G bill, calling it an attack on Mahatma Gandhi's ideals and the rights of rural poor. The proposed legislation aims to replace the MGNREGA scheme by shifting 40% of funding responsibility to states and centralizing decision-making power. Opposition leaders have united against the bill, particularly objecting to the removal of Mahatma Gandhi's name and the financial burden it places on state governments.

    Maharashtra Farmer Sells Kidney After Rs 1 Lakh Loan Escalates to Rs 74 Lakh Due to Predatory Lending

    Dec 16, 2025 06:31 pm CST

    A desperate Maharashtra farmer was forced to sell his kidney in Cambodia after his initial Rs 1 lakh loan ballooned to Rs 74 lakh due to predatory interest rates. Despite selling his land and possessions, Roshan Sadashiv Kude could not escape the debt trap set by six identified moneylenders, leading him to threaten self-immolation if authorities fail to intervene.
